Beachwood Schools 2014 Annual Report Popular Annual Report for the Fiscal Year Ended June 30, 2014 Dear Beachwood Residents, Beachwood City Schools’2014 Popular Annual Report highlights our students’ academic achievements, contains a profile of our district and its offerings, and reports our district’s financial data for Fiscal Year 2014. It is available on our web site at beachwoodschools.org. The following pages provide a synopsis of this Annual Report with snapshots of information that are most significant to Beachwood taxpayers. On these pages, you’ll see that your schools are in excellent financial health. With more than $5 million in operating efficiencies since the district’s last operating levy in 2005, Beachwood’s tax rate is still one of the lowest in the area. Meanwhile, Beachwood’s children continue to excel as we expand academic programming. Our 110.6 Performance Index on the 2013-2014 district report card ranked eighth in Ohio. DISTRICT PROFILE Enrollment: 1,526 students Average Class Size: 117 students (per grade) Pupil/Teacher Ratio: 11.1-to-1 Faculty: 161 certificated teachers, 85% with Master’s degrees and/or PhDs Average Teaching Experience: 12.4 years (in Beachwood) Advanced Placement: 25 AP courses; 2014 recognition by College Board 2013-2014 DISTRICT REPORT CARD • 110.6 Performance Index is the highest in the district’s history • Ranked #3 among Cuyahoga County’s 31 public school districts • Ranked #8 among Ohio’s 611 public school districts • 24 out of 24 Indicators Met • ‘A’ grades in nearly every category, including Value-Added & Gap-Closing • 99% of students scored proficient or better in 4th grade OAA reading • 5th grade math scores ranked #1 in Northeast Ohio STUDENT ACHIEVEMENTS FINANCIAL REPORTS See the following pages for the Beachwood City Schools’ academic highlights for the 2013-2014.
